Что реально можно восстановить из удалённых сообщений Telegram на Android

Короткий ответ: вернуть удалённое можно лишь в ограниченных случаях — из кэша приложения, истории уведомлений, из заранее сделанного бэкапа или при наличии рут‑доступа; 100% гарантии нет. Ниже — практические шаги для каждого метода и ограничения.

Как работает удаление в Telegram и что ожидать

  • Сообщения, удалённые "для всех", обычно удаляются с серверов и становятся недоступны для обоих участников.
  • Секретные чаты с самоуничтожением восстановить нельзя ни при каких условиях.
  • Чаще всего удаётся вернуть медиа (фото/видео) из кэша, реже — текст.

Если сообщение удалено "для всех" более нескольких дней, вероятность восстановления близка к нулю.

Практические способы восстановления (шаги)

  1. Через кэш приложения (без рут)
  • Не пользуйтесь очисткой кэша. Откройте Настройки Android → Приложения → Telegram → Хранилище и убедитесь, что кэш не очищен.
  • Установите файловый менеджер и откройте папки: /Android/data/org.telegram.messenger/cache/ или /storage/emulated/0/Android/data/org.telegram.messenger/.
  • Ищите новые файлы без расширений или папки с временными именами; медиа можно открыть в галерее, текстовые фрагменты — в текстовом редакторе.
  • Шанс: 40–60% для медиа, значительно ниже для текста.
  1. История уведомлений
  • Если приходили push‑уведомления, их текст может сохраниться в системной истории уведомлений.
  • Установите приложение для просмотра истории уведомлений и дайте разрешение на чтение уведомлений в настройках системы.
  • Откройте запись уведомлений Telegram и ищите нужный текст. Работает только если уведомления были включены и в чате не включена опция скрытия содержимого.

В чате Telegram: Дополнительно → Параметры уведомлений → отключите «Скрыть содержимое», чтобы уведомления сохраняли текст.

  1. Экспорт/бэкап заранее (лучший вариант)
  • Экспортируйте данные Telegram заранее (через настройки приложения — экспорт данных) или организуйте автосохранение копий в другом чате/файле.
  • Экспорт даёт полный доступ к переписке на момент экспорта — восстановление гарантировано из этого файла.
  1. При наличии рут‑прав (для продвинутых)
  • С рутом можно скопировать базу данных Telegram: /data/data/org.telegram.messenger/databases/ (например cache4.db).
  • Скопируйте файл на ПК и откройте в SQLite‑редакторе: SELECT * FROM messages WHERE chat_id = [ID];
  • Риск: потеря гарантии, возможные проблемы с безопасностью. Шанс восстановить — высокий для недавних удалений.

Сравнение методов

МетодТребованияЧто восстанавливаетШанс
КэшНет рутаМедиа, иногда текст40–60%
УведомленияВключённые пушиТекст пуша20–40%
БэкапПредварительно созданВсё, что было в момент бэкапа~100%
РутРут‑доступБольшая часть базы≈90%

Частые ошибки

  • Очищать кэш сразу после потери данных — уменьшает шанс восстановления.
  • Искать секретные чаты в кэше — они шифруются и не восстанавливаются.
  • Полагаться на сторонние «восстановители» без прав — многие приложения дают ложную надежду.

FAQ

  • Можно ли вернуть сообщение, удалённое другим пользователем? Часто нет: если оно удалено "для всех", серверы Telegram удаляют копии.
  • Поможет ли установка приложения восстановления после удаления? Если кэш или уведомление уже стерты — нет. Такие приложения работают только при предварительной установке.
  • Законно ли копирование базы с рутом? Технически возможно, но нарушение правил устройства/гарантии — ваша ответственность.

Если ничего не помогло — примите это как особенность мессенджера и настройте регулярные бэкапы и сохранение важных файлов заранее.